**Ticket: Localized Date Formats in Fernwick Dashboard**

All dates in the Fernwick dashboard currently render in a fixed format. This ticket switches rendering to locale-aware formatting using the user's profile setting, with a fallback to the browser locale. Contractors should update the shared formatter utility only, not individual views. Merge requires sign-off from the owner named below.

account owner for kafop-haweg: Pelax Gilael Istir

Internal Memo — Q4 Cash-Flow Forecast

Hi branch managers — quick heads-up on the Q4 numbers. Collections from the Brintley accounts came in stronger than expected, so we're projecting a modest surplus through December. That said, the Farrowdale expansion will eat into reserves in January, so keep discretionary spending tight. Full spreadsheets land next week. For now, here's the short version of where this is heading.

confidential, bahap-bajog: Zorethix Works is in early talks to buy Kelethox Foods for about $30.7 million. The Ralvan launch date is September 19, and nothing goes to the press before then.

Quarterly Planning Note — Westmoor Expansion

For the incoming director: we intend to open two sites in the Westmoor region during Q2, anchored by the Aldercroft distribution hub. Local hiring begins next month; Tern's team handles permits. Initial stock will ship from the Fennick warehouse until the hub is operational. Revenue expectations are modest for year one. The strategic reasoning, which remains confidential, is set out in the note below.

internal memo for hahif-hahaf: Headcount on the Zorwyn team goes from 9 to 100 by the end of October. Gross margin on Zorwyn came in at 5 percent against a plan of 10 percent.

Finance Review Summary — Project Amberline Launch

The Amberline handheld scanner remains on track for a Q3 launch. Tooling costs came in 8% over plan; marketing spend was trimmed to compensate. Unit margin holds at 41% assuming current component pricing from Vexley Components. Working capital needs peak in month two post-launch. Finance should pre-approve the contingency line before the go decision. One strategic consideration follows.

board note of bawep-tajef: Queniusek Systems plans to raise the Quenvan list price by 53.1 percent in March. The pricing group signed off on a budget of $176.4 million for Project Drueth. The renewal with Casionix Partners closes at $142.5 million a year, 8.3 percent below the last contract. Project Fraax slips by six weeks because of the tooling delay.